    Hi,
    I logged a call with AppleCare & have since had explained why this occurs (some time ago)
    I'll try to explain what was indicated to me.
    iOS has a limited Font Set & this affects what PDFs can display. You need to use iOS supported fonts in your PDFs to see/read them properly  
    These supported fonts are indicated here => http://support.apple.com/kb/HT4980
    Regards MS office docs, iOS doesn't have much of an API to work with MS Office documents at all so is stuck with 3rd Party Apps to try to do it.
    Unfortunately Mail in/on iOS uses the API to attempt to open/use MS Office attachments unless you tell it to use an App to open the attachment.
    I have had success opening & reading MS office docs now with CloudOn, but find it slow & very awkward to use.
    Not too sure if this helps others, but at least it explains why this is occurring
